返回
Mac OS X 上 Node.js 卸载与重装故障排除:彻底卸载并重新安装 Node.js
javascript
2024-03-13 11:28:43
Mac OS X 上彻底卸载并重新安装 Node.js:故障排除指南
引言
Node.js 是一个强大的 JavaScript 运行时环境,为广泛的应用程序和工具提供支持。在 Mac OS X 上,可以通过多种方式安装 Node.js,包括使用 Homebrew 和 NVM(Node 版本管理器)。然而,当遇到版本冲突或其他问题时,彻底卸载并重新安装整个环境可能成为必要的故障排除步骤。本指南将引导你完成在 Mac OS X 上彻底卸载并重新安装 Node.js 的过程。
卸载 NVM
NVM 允许你轻松地在你的系统上管理多个 Node.js 版本。要卸载 NVM,请运行以下命令:
cur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.39.1/uninstall.sh | bash
卸载 Node.js
使用 Homebrew
如果你使用 Homebrew 安装了 Node.js,请使用以下命令卸载它:
brew uninstall node
使用 macOS 包管理器
如果你使用 macOS 系统自带的包管理器安装了 Node.js,请运行以下命令:
sudo rm -rf /usr/local/lib/node_modules/
sudo rm -rf /usr/local/include/node
sudo rm -rf /usr/local/bin/node
卸载 npm
npm 是随 Node.js 一起安装的包管理器。要卸载它,请运行以下命令:
npm uninstall -g npm
重新安装 NVM
按照 NVM 官方指南重新安装 NVM:
https://github.com/nvm-sh/nvm#installation
重新安装 Node.js
使用 NVM 安装最新版本
nvm install node
使用 NVM 安装特定版本
nvm install 16.14.0
验证安装
要验证 Node.js 是否成功安装,请运行以下命令:
node -v
故障排除提示
- 在执行任何卸载或安装操作之前,请确保备份任何重要的数据或配置。
- 如果在卸载或安装过程中遇到困难,请参考 NVM 官方文档或 Homebrew 文档。
- 保持你的 Node.js 和 npm 版本是最新的,可以帮助避免版本冲突和兼容性问题。
常见问题解答
1. 我如何知道我系统上安装了哪些 Node.js 版本?
nvm ls
2. 如何删除特定的 Node.js 版本?
nvm uninstall 16.14.0
3. 如何切换到不同的 Node.js 版本?
nvm use 16.14.0
4. 如何更新 npm?
npm install -g npm
5. 如何升级 Node.js 到最新版本?
nvm install node